We've No Preferred Candidate For Senate Presidency, Says APC
The All Progressives Congress on Friday declared its neutrality on the issue of who emerges Senate President in the 8th National Assembly.
The party's position came on the heels of reports that the Senator representing Kwara Central, Dr. Bukola Saraki, has purportedly received the secret endorsement of about 70 senators drawn from across the six geo-political zones of the country.
Speaking with Saturday PUNCH in Abuja, APC National Publicity Secretary, Alhaji Lai Mohammed, said the party currently had no preferred candidate.
Mohammed said, "As of today, as I am speaking to you, the party does not have a preferred candidate. Like in every political contest, all those who are qualified and are interested are free to campaign to their colleagues and we cannot stop them"
It was gathered that party leaders from across the six geo-political zones succeeded in hammering it on the party to build upon the success of its presidential primaries by supporting a transparent process. Meanwhile, a senator-elect, who is on the campaign team of Saraki has revealed that the former Kwara governor has secured the support of 70 senators.
The senator-elect, who pleaded anonymity because of the sensitivity of the issue, said, "We have been meeting. I can tell you that from the meetings we have had so far, Saraki's support base is increasing. We were close to 70 at the last meeting".
Saraki, it was learnt, is relying on his former governor colleagues who are now senators-elect.
